Answer: HA Volumizing Filler For Diminishing Under-Eye Bags; Unpneeq For Eyelid Ptosis At least from the photos provided there appears to be significant volume loss in the upper cheek/lower lid regions, and since this region is a primary support for the infraorbital region, volume loss in the region inevitably leads to the development of under-eye bags, tear troughs and hollows. Since this is the likely scenario here, the use of an appropriately robust HA volumizing filler properly injected into this region can help to diminish, often significantly, the aforementioned problems. As to the left eye, at least from the photos, this appears to more of an issue of eyelid ptosis, rather than hooding. For this, you might wish to discuss with your doctor the use of Upneeq, an FDA-approved, once-daily drop for treating this problem. It is expensive, but you may wish to discuss the use of generic oxymetazoline ophthalmic preparations as an alternative. You would be wise to consult with a board certified cosmetic dermatologist.
